The following are a couple of suggestions to aid you to not only stay slim, but conserve some money in the process as well. Before you press on with any work out exertion, do not forget to consult first with your doctor. Further, having a pair of training shoes would help out a lot.

  1. Walk to work if you live just several blocks away. In place of hailing a cab or driving, sport your running shoes and put those leg muscles to work. This will help you save on gasoline and rid of calories at the same time! In case your house is far-off from your work, park a couple of blocks away and walk the rest of the way.
  2. Get off the elevator a few floors shy of your office and take advantage of the stairs. It would be even better if you could scale the stairs all the way from the ground!
  3. Take advantage of parks and jogging paths. These are often free to use and a good way to socialize with other health fans as well. Be alert and you might cull a number of advice that they may be ready to share. All you would need is a pair of good training shoes and you got yourself free use of Mother Nature’s treadmill.
  4. Do quick stretches during work. Continued hours of sitting and doing work will cramp your muscles. Take a recess by performing some primary leg, arm, and back stretches. This should not take up 2 minutes of your time and is a good way to keep step with your work out pace.
  5. Instead of hiring help, do your own loft cleaning. All that mopping, scrubbing, and vacuuming will put your entire body to work. You’re sure to sweat 5 minutes into it.
  6. Pick a sport and give it your best stab. Your target is not to win so don’t torture yourself if you don’t play good. You want to work a sweat and get rid of those gross undesirable fats. It would be more desirable if you can find buddies to accompany you.
  7. Work out when having a night-out! Go to dance clubs or watch a concert rather than spending the night just sitting and drinking alcohol. This is yet another instance of blending work out with fun!
